METHOD OF ISOLATION OF POLYHYDROXYAIKANOATES (PHAS) FROM BIOMASS FERMENTED BY MICROORGANISMS PRODUCING POLYHYDROXYAIKANOATES (PHAS) AND/OR FROM BIOMASS CONTAINING AT LEAST ONE CROP-PLANT PRODUCING POLYHYDROXYAIKANOATES
Original language description
The invention relates to a method of isolation of polyhydroxyalkanoates from biomass containing polyhydroxyalkanoates comprising the steps of extracting components of the biomass other than polyhydroxyalkanoates from the biomass by means of an extraction agent based on alkyl alcohol having 2 to 4 carbon atoms in the chain, separating the extract containing these components from the extraction solution thus obtained, removing the remainder of the extraction agent from the solid phase by distillation with an aqueous solution or by stripping with water vapour or by drying, extracting from the solid phase thus pre-cleaned polyhydroxyalkanoates by an extraction agent based on chlorinated hydrocarbon, separating the polyhydroxyalkanoates from the extraction solution thus obtained, and feeding this extract to a circulation loop in order to obtain a polyhydroxyalkanoates precipitate.
